Top 5 Bubble Shooter Games on iOS in Europe: Q4 2023
In Q4 2023, the top 5 bubble shooter games on iOS in Europe saw significant engagement with notable trends in downloads, revenue, and active users, according to Sensor Tower data.
In the fourth quarter of 2023, the top five bubble shooter games on iOS in Europe exhibited impressive performance metrics, as revealed by Sensor Tower data. Here's a detailed look at how each game fared in terms of downloads, revenue, and weekly active users.
QSWatermelon : Monkey Land from Han Song Ey Jo saw a remarkable rise in downloads, beginning with around 30K in mid-October and peaking at over 555K in early December. The game's revenue followed a similar upward trajectory, starting at $26 and reaching approximately $590 by late December. Weekly active users also surged from 27K to nearly 2.7M over the quarter.
Juicy Merge - Melon Game by MagicLab experienced a notable increase in downloads, starting with just 41 in late October and peaking at around 312K in early November. Revenue saw a peak of $5.6K in early November, with a subsequent decline to about $925 by the end of December. The weekly active users for this game saw a high of nearly 384K in mid-November before stabilizing around 147K by the end of the quarter.
Watermelon Fruits Match Puzzle from Abdul Rehman Al Oweis had a steady growth in downloads, starting with 303 in late October and reaching over 127K by early December. Weekly active users followed a similar pattern, growing from 179 to over 227K by mid-December.
Watermelon Drop: Fruit Merge by Getsmart LLC launched in November and quickly gained traction, with downloads rising from 479 to over 93K by mid-December. Weekly active users also saw significant growth, starting at 386 and reaching nearly 230K by the end of December.
Bubble Pop! Puzzle Game Legend from BitMango, Inc. maintained a steady performance throughout the quarter. Downloads hovered between 34K and 47K, while revenue remained consistent, fluctuating around the $8K to $10K mark. Weekly active users also showed stability, rising from 171K to around 220K by the end of December.
